The highly anticipated perjury trial of Baseball star Barry Bonds has been postponed - possibly for months. A flurry of court proceedings in February led the presiding judge in the case to announce that jury selection scheduled to start that week would not take place.

The day began with Bonds' former personal trainer, Greg Anderson, telling U.S. District Court Judge Susan Illston that he would not testify about Bonds at the trial. Anderson has served time in prison for contempt of court after taking a similar stance in past proceedings.

Earlier in February, Illston ruled that some key prosecution evidence would be inadmissible at trial if Anderson weren't there to testify about it. The evidence included positive drugs tests allegedly by Bonds and so-called "doping calendars" belonging to Anderson that allegedly laid out a schedule for Bonds' drug use.
